This document discusses different types and approaches to artificial intelligence:
1. The Turing Test approach aims to create AI that can converse with humans in natural language without being distinguished from a human. This requires capabilities in natural language processing, knowledge representation, automated reasoning, and machine learning.
2. The cognitive modeling approach seeks to understand human thought through introspection, psychological experiments observing human behavior, and brain imaging to then model human thinking in AI.
3. The "laws of thought" approach uses logic and probability to model rational thought, moving from perception to understanding how the world works to predicting the future.

Artificial intelligence has a long history dating back to ancient Greece. Significant early work was done by Alan Turing in the 1930s. The term "artificial intelligence" was coined by John McCarthy in 1956. Today, AI is used for driverless cars, automated assembly lines, surgical robots, and next-generation traffic control. The future of AI depends on whether strong human-level AI can be achieved, but challenges remain around understanding human-level intelligence and consciousness.

Artificial intelligence (AI) is the development of computer systems able to perform tasks normally requiring human intelligence, such as visual perception and decision-making. There are three types of AI: narrow AI, which is limited in scope; general AI at an advanced level similar to human intelligence; and super AI, which would surpass human intelligence. AI has many applications today including personal assistants on phones, gaming, robotics, and self-driving cars. While AI shows promise, it also presents risks if not developed responsibly, as machines currently lack human attributes like emotions and ethics.
